England Captain Harry Kane Thriving Despite Lack of Strike Partner, Says Emile Heskey
Former England striker Emile Heskey believes that Harry Kane, despite not having a strike partner alongside him, is still capable of scoring goals and remains one of the best No.9s in the business. Heskey’s comments come amid speculation about Kane’s role in the England national team and whether he would benefit from playing alongside another forward.

Emile Heskey’s Assessment
Emile Heskey, who himself had a successful career as a striker for England, believes that Harry Kane does not necessarily need a strike partner to succeed. Heskey acknowledges the benefits of having another forward alongside Kane but emphasizes that the England captain is more than capable of scoring goals on his own.
Despite calls for Kane to have a strike partner to ease the goal-scoring burden on him, Heskey believes that Kane’s individual talent and goal-scoring instincts make him a formidable force on the pitch. His ability to create scoring opportunities for himself and his teammates sets him apart from other players in his position.

The Evolution of the Modern Striker
In modern football, the role of the striker has evolved to encompass more than just scoring goals. Strikers are now expected to contribute to the team’s build-up play, press defensively, and create space for their teammates. Harry Kane embodies this new breed of striker, showcasing a multifaceted skill set that extends beyond traditional goal-scoring duties.
As the game continues to evolve, Kane’s versatility and adaptability as a striker have become increasingly valuable. His ability to link play, hold up the ball, and dictate the tempo of the game highlight his importance as a complete forward capable of influencing the outcome of matches in various ways.
